Meso
/ˈmɛsoʊ/noun
A combining form meaning “middle” or “intermediate,” especially in scientific terms.
Did you know?Meso- comes from Greek mesos, the same ancient root behind words for the middle, the median, and the mesosphere—literally the “middle sphere” of the sky.
